[PATCH v2 2/2] platform/x86: oxpec: Report tablet mode on OneXPlayer detachables
From: Alexander Egorov
Date: Tue Jul 28 2026 - 04:39:35 EST
The OneXPlayer X1 family and Super X have detachable pogo-pin
keyboards. The firmware does not expose a tablet-mode input switch.
The Super X keyboard enumerates as 1a86:1305. The X1 family folio
keyboard enumerates as 258a:001e.
Register an input device on these boards and report SW_TABLET_MODE from
the model-specific pogo keyboard USB hotplug state. Other USB and
Bluetooth keyboards do not affect the switch.
A complete dump of the 256-byte Super X EC register map was compared
with the keyboard attached, detached, and reattached. No register
changed predictably with the attachment state.
Tested on a OneXPlayer Super X. Mutter enables accelerometer-driven
display rotation only while the pogo keyboard is absent.

+#define OXP_KEYBOARD_VID_QINHENG 0x1a86
+#define OXP_KEYBOARD_PID_K2445 0x1305
+#define OXP_KEYBOARD_VID_HAILUCK 0x258a
+#define OXP_KEYBOARD_PID_HAILUCK 0x001e
+
+static int oxp_find_keyboard(struct usb_device *udev, void *data)
+{
+ bool *keyboard_attached = data;
+ u16 vid = le16_to_cpu(udev->descriptor.idVendor);
+ u16 pid = le16_to_cpu(udev->descriptor.idProduct);
+
+ switch (board) {
+ case oxp_x1:
+ if (vid == OXP_KEYBOARD_VID_HAILUCK &&
+ pid == OXP_KEYBOARD_PID_HAILUCK)
+ *keyboard_attached = true;
+ break;
+ case oxp_super_x:
+ if (vid == OXP_KEYBOARD_VID_QINHENG &&
+ pid == OXP_KEYBOARD_PID_K2445)
+ *keyboard_attached = true;
+ break;
+ default:
+ break;
+ }
+
+ return 0;
+}
+
+static int oxp_usb_notify(struct notifier_block *nb,
+ unsigned long action, void *data)
+{
+ struct usb_device *udev = data;
+ u16 vid = le16_to_cpu(udev->descriptor.idVendor);
+ u16 pid = le16_to_cpu(udev->descriptor.idProduct);
+ bool keyboard = false;
+
+ switch (board) {
+ case oxp_x1:
+ keyboard = vid == OXP_KEYBOARD_VID_HAILUCK &&
+ pid == OXP_KEYBOARD_PID_HAILUCK;
+ break;
+ case oxp_super_x:
+ keyboard = vid == OXP_KEYBOARD_VID_QINHENG &&
+ pid == OXP_KEYBOARD_PID_K2445;
+ break;
+ default:
+ break;
+ }
+
+ if (!keyboard)
+ return NOTIFY_DONE;
+
+ switch (action) {
+ case USB_DEVICE_ADD:
+ input_report_switch(oxp_tablet_mode_input, SW_TABLET_MODE, false);
+ break;
+ case USB_DEVICE_REMOVE:
+ input_report_switch(oxp_tablet_mode_input, SW_TABLET_MODE, true);
+ break;
+ default:
+ return NOTIFY_DONE;
+ }
+
+ input_sync(oxp_tablet_mode_input);
+ return NOTIFY_OK;
+}
